Ashwagandha (Withania somnifera) is a herb that has been used for centuries in Ayurvedic practices to support general health and wellbeing. Today, it is backed by science to help the body adjust to life’s daily challenges by improving sleep quality & reducing sleeplessness.
Today ashwagandha is a popular choice for helping to support refreshing sleep and emotional wellbeing.
Ashwagandha offers a range of benefits to help support everyday wellbeing. It assists the body in coping with environmental stress and supports a healthy stress response in the body.


Calm the mind
Ashwagandha can help calm the mind, reduce feelings of nervous tension, and relieve mild symptoms of stress and mild anxiety.


Improve deep, quality sleep
It is backed by science to help reduce the time it takes to fall asleep, reduce sleeplessness & improve deep, quality sleep.


Support emotional wellbeing
It also helps support emotional wellbeing and relieves irritability, making it helpful for maintaining a sense of calm during busy times.
